summaryrefslogtreecommitdiffstats
path: root/plugins/omelasticsearch/cJSON/tests/test5
diff options
context:
space:
mode:
authorRainer Gerhards <rgerhards@adiscon.com>2013-01-22 16:55:21 +0100
committerRainer Gerhards <rgerhards@adiscon.com>2013-01-22 16:55:21 +0100
commit35bec820b601bfcf9eff314fbfc718bb8949bda1 (patch)
treee67ec971d8d89df26727330e527df955535410f3 /plugins/omelasticsearch/cJSON/tests/test5
parent45d11af0b9975937e536d1c9b6d7bdaff5ade1b0 (diff)
downloadrsyslog-35bec820b601bfcf9eff314fbfc718bb8949bda1.tar.gz
rsyslog-35bec820b601bfcf9eff314fbfc718bb8949bda1.tar.bz2
rsyslog-35bec820b601bfcf9eff314fbfc718bb8949bda1.zip
optimze: reduce memory operations during dns resolution/hostname setting
previously, hostname and ip strings were shuffled to the msg object, which created a property out of them. Now the cache holds the property, and it is resused (almost) everywhere, what saves a lot of memory operations. The only exception is imtcp session setup, where different handling of the hostname is done, which we need to sort out (but that's another story).
Diffstat (limited to 'plugins/omelasticsearch/cJSON/tests/test5')
0 files changed, 0 insertions, 0 deletions